Current vs. 2025 Solar Panel Price Projections
2023 Average Prices
Monocrystalline Panels: PKR 45–65/watt (High efficiency, ideal for rooftops)
Polycrystalline Panels: PKR 35–50/watt (Budget-friendly, moderate efficiency)
Thin-Film Panels: PKR 25–40/watt (Lightweight, low efficiency)
2025 Price Predictions
Monocrystalline: PKR 38–55/watt (↓12–15% due to tech advancements)
Polycrystalline: PKR 28–42/watt (↓10–12% as demand shifts to mono)
Thin-Film: PKR 20–32/watt (↓8–10% with improved manufacturing)
Note: Prices vary by brand (e.g., Canadian Solar, JA Solar) and import policies.

Key Factors Influencing 2025 Solar Prices
1. Import Duties & Taxes
Current 17% import duty on solar panels may reduce if government renews green energy incentives.
2. Local Manufacturing Growth
Companies like Reon Energy and Tesla’s rumored entry could stabilize prices through local production.
3. Exchange Rate Fluctuations
PKR volatility against USD impacts import costs. A stable rupee could lower prices.
4. Global Raw Material Costs
Polysilicon prices, which dropped 70% in 2023, may further decrease, reducing panel costs.
Total Solar System Cost Breakdown
A 5kW system (suitable for a medium-sized home) includes:
Panel: PKR 500,000–700,000 (2025 estimate)
Inverter: PKR 100,000-150,000 (Cross breed inverters add 20% expense)
Batteries: PKR 200,000-300,000 (Lithium-particle liked for life span)
Establishment: PKR 50,000-80,000
Full scale Measure: PKR 850,000-1.23 million (versus PKR 1.1-1.5 million of each 2023)
